Oprava služby Windows Update přestane běžet

Stránky aktualizovány :
Datum vytvoření stránky :

úkaz

Windows XP, Windows Server 2003, Windows Server 2003 R2

Výše uvedené operační systémy nemají vyhrazenou obrazovku Windows Update, ale spíše přistupují k webu společnosti Microsoft prostřednictvím webového prohlížeče a provádějí službu Windows Update.

Když spustíte "Windows Update" nebo "Microsoft Update" z "Nabídky Start", internet Explorer se otevře a otevře stránku Windows Update, ale dojde k jevu, který opakovaně aktualizuje stránky na webu.

Pokud se podíváte na adresní řádek, při každém obnovení obrazovky je adresa

  • http://update.microsoft.com/microsoftupdate/v6/default.aspx?ln=ja
  • http://update.microsoft.com/microsoftupdate/v6/default.aspx?ln=ja&muopt=1
  • http://update.microsoft.com/microsoftupdate/v6/default.aspx?ln=ja&muopt=1&muopt=1
  • http://update.microsoft.com/microsoftupdate/v6/default.aspx?ln=ja&muopt=1&muopt=1&muopt=1
  • http://update.microsoft.com/microsoftupdate/v6/default.aspx?ln=ja&muopt=1&muopt=1&muopt=1&muopt=1

Jako takový můžete vidět, že parametr "&muopt=1" je přidán a spadá do nekonečné smyčky. Mimochodem, odtud už dál jít nemůžu.

Windows Vista, Windows 7, Windows Server 2008, Windows Server 2008 R2

Ve výše uvedeném operačním systému se při spuštění služby Windows Update zobrazí vyhrazená obrazovka. Pokud je to normální, můžete pokračovat ve spouštění služby Windows Update tak, jak je, ale pokud je prostředí zastaralé, může to vypadat jako obrázek.

Pokud kliknete na tlačítko "Zkontrolovat aktualizace", může to pokračovat normálně tak, jak je, ale může se zobrazit chyba, jak je znázorněno na obrázku. V tomto případě restartování služby nebo restartování systému Windows podle zprávy často nepomůže.

Usnesení

Tato část popisuje postupy v prostředí systému Windows Server 2003 R2. Postup je téměř stejný v jiných operačních systémech. Obrazovka služby Windows Update je odlišná, ale v podstatě není problém, pokud budete postupovat podle toku zobrazeného na obrazovce.

Nejprve se přihlaste jako uživatel s oprávněními ve skupině Administrators.

Otevřete textový editor a zadejte níže uvedený obsah a klikněte na rozšíření ". bat" soubor. Název souboru může být libovolný.

net stop wuauserv
cd %systemroot%
rd /s /q SoftwareDistributionold
ren SoftwareDistribution SoftwareDistributionold
net start wuauserv
net stop bits
net start bits
net stop cryptsvc
cd %systemroot%\system32
rd /s /q catroot2old
ren catroot2 catroot2old
net start cryptsvc

Po uložení souboru jej spusťte dvojitým kliknutím. V systémech Windows Vista a Windows 7 klikněte pravým tlačítkem myši na soubor a vyberte příkaz Spustit jako správce.

Počkejte, až se příkazový řádek automaticky otevře a zavře.

Po dokončení restartujte systém Windows. Možná nebudete muset restartovat, ale je to spolehlivější.

Po dokončení restartování zkuste spustit službu Windows Update. Jak je znázorněno na obrázku, budete vyzváni k aktualizaci samotné služby Windows Update, takže postupujte podle postupu (obsah obrazovky se může lišit v závislosti na prostředí). Až budete hotovi, můžete spustit službu Windows Update.